Understanding Progressive Web Apps: Beyond the Basics

First coined by Google in 2015, PWAs are web applications that leverage modern browser APIs to deliver app-like experiences directly within the browser. They integrate features such as offline access, push notifications, and home screen installation—bringing native app functionality without requiring users to download from app stores.

What makes PWAs particularly compelling is their adaptability across devices and operating systems, minimizing fragmentation that has historically challenged developers. The Role of Browser APIs & the PWA Ecosystem

Modern browser APIs underpin the capabilities of PWAs, including:

  • Service Workers: Enable offline experiences and background sync.
  • Web App Manifest: Define the app’s appearance on the home screen, icon, and launch behavior.
  • Push API: Deliver timely notifications to re-engage users.

This ecosystem has matured, with Chromium-based browsers leading the way, closely followed by Firefox, Safari, and Microsoft Edge, each enhancing support and performance metrics.

Implementing PWA Optimization Strategies

To maximize the benefits, publishers should incorporate:

  1. Responsive Design: Seamless experience across all device sizes.
  2. Fast Load Times: Prioritize performance optimization and efficient caching strategies.
  3. Progressive Enhancement: Ensure core functionalities work even on browsers with limited API support.
  4. Easy Installation: Encourage users to add the site to their home screen for recurring engagement.
